The chemiluminescence of the Cypridina luciferin analogue. hoxyphenyl)
-3,7-dihydroimidazo[1,2-a]pyrazin-3-one (MCLA) was observed at 462 nm
in the presence of horseradish peroxidase(HRP) and the total spectrum
of light emitted was found to depend linearly on HRP concentration. Me
thods for the determination of HRP concentration using the chemilumine
scence was investigated. HRP could be detected in the range from 100 p
mol/L to 100 nmol/L under the optimum condition, H2O2 (10 mmol/L) and
MCLA (10 mu mol/L) at pH 5.8.
